My car is a 2005 mustang gt with only 20250 miles.i usually keep it in the garage, mainly driving on pleasant weekends.on wednesday the 11th, i was driving in a heavy rain when the car suddenly lost almost all electrical components (i.e. No power to any lights, radio, power windows, door locks etc.).all of the idiot lights came on indicating failure across the board.the traction control was also turned off.when i got it home, i noticed that the passenger side carpet was wet.i opened the passenger side access panel and discovered water dripping from the gem (generic electric module).the unit had obviously shorted out causing the problems (confirmed by web research at several mustang web sites).neither the dealership or ford will pay for the repair because the car is 5 years old, even though it has low mileage.the extended warranty i purchased does not cover this damage either.searching ford's tsbs, revealed a tsb on the water problem, but nothing on the gem.ford is aware of the situation, based on other complaints, but has not recalled the vehicle.the vehicle is in the process of drying out and has not been repaired.estimated cost is around $1000.00i believe this is a critical issue.had this problem occurred during nighttime i would have been instantly blind due to the loss of headlights, and hidden from other drivers due to lack of rear lights and turn indicators.with the loss of traction control while driving in the rain, the chance of loosing control of the vehicle is an increaseddanger to the occupants, other drivers, pedestrians, and property.this car should be recalled.

After parking the mustang in the garage for a couple weeks until i had time to check the status of the car. I noticed the floor of the cab (passenger side) was damp. The car battery was dead (less than a year old, red top optima) and there was mold actually growing in parts of the interior of the car. I did some research regarding this issue and found it common from a failed plug under the windshield wipers next to the a/c filter. Causing the water to fill up between the firewall and the engine compartment, and ultimately leaking inside the cab onto the sjb (smart junction box) located directly behind the firewall on the passenger side. Design of the cabin air intake box and drain led to a back flow of water during a heavy downpour.this led to water flowing through the air ducts and into the passenger compartment behind the glove box.ford placed 4"x6" piece of foam over the smart junction box in an effort to "bandage the problem, rather than correcting the cause.as water entered the cabin area, it soaked the smart junction box to fail which may have been the proximate cause for the engine dying.end result is that the smart junction box must be replaced and programmed.

1. Beginning at approximately april, 2008, my 2005 ford mustang gt began to leak water inside the cabin in the passenger footwell whenever it rained hard or snowed.2. The failure is a grommet that clogs up underneath the cabin air filter. It's very difficult to reach unless you're a certified mechanic.3. The ford dealer has cleared out the area around the grommet, but it is a constantly recurring problem that ford has issued a tsb for, but they haven't issued a recall for since it usually happens after the warranty expires.
